Transaction 63a688338591484b0341ef249e9c4dd1916e7f851e7097aa96fa9751bd06ce62
1 Input
1 Output
-
63a688338591484b0341ef249e9c4dd1916e7f851e7097aa96fa9751bd06ce62:0
- value
- 32140056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64d0519c5de2079eeab23edb7e29df7f7bf29063 OP_EQUAL
- address
- 3At53yE75oEShyzeguXkmFdXi3TEANxMso